£350? Is that for fronts or all 4? This is a post from godspeed on another thread:

We charge £85 per front caliper to completely strip them , paint strip , bead blast and either prime and spray and lacquer them the original colour , or we can paint them any other colour , or we are now set up to powder coat them but only have certain colours available at the moment.
We polish the pistons and chemically clean the seals , as long as they are not damaged they can be re-used , if they are damaged they will be replaced , front seals are £55 per caliper and rears are £40

We apply new logo's and pressure test them.
